Teeth whitening is a cosmetic dental procedure that aims to improve the appearance of discoloured or stained teeth. It involves using chemicals, usually hydrogen peroxide or carbamide peroxide, to remove surface stains and brighten the teeth.

Special dental bleaching agents, namely hydrogen peroxide and carbamide peroxide very effectively remove surface stains from the enamel of the teeth. Some “whitening” toothpastes can achieve this result to a very limited degree. However, when used as recommended, the bleaching products we provide not only remove surface staining but penetrate the tooth enamel and break down the compounds that cause discoloration in the deeper layers of the tooth, effectively removing the discolouration you can’t just brush away. We believe the most cost-effective way to whiten your teeth is to apply the bleaching agent, in the form of a gel, at home in custom-made plastic trays, ie mini-mouthguards. All that’s required is for an impression (mould) of your teeth to be taken and we make the customized tray(s).
Apply the bleaching gel as recommended and you’ll see the change within days.
Please note that tooth bleaching may not change the shade of existing fillings and it’s not recommended for those with untreated gum disease, or patients with severe tooth sensitivity. Our dentists can assess your suitability for tooth whitening.
